In Search of Darkness is gearing up to tackle the back half of the โ€˜90s, and today, Bloody Disgusting revealed the trailer for the seriesโ€™ trip into meta movie madness. In Search of Darkness: 1995-1999, just opened pre orders, and thereโ€™s something for everyone in this one. 

As the title makes obvious, the documentary will cover the making of the iconic horror films of the back half of the โ€˜90s, including but not limited to Scream, I Know What You Did Last Summer, The Craft, Bride of Chucky, The Sixth Sense, Ring, and The Blair Witch Project. As with the other installments of In Search of Darkness, the new late โ€˜90s edition will feature interviews and commentary from some of the most recognizable faces in the genre, including John Carpenter, Doug Bradley, Mike Flanagan, Andrew Divoff, Corbin Bernsen, Marco Beltrami, and Akela Cooper, among others. 

โ€œIt was an exciting time for horror movie fans, and the new In Search of Darkness: 1995-1999 captures that lightning-in-a-bottle era with its signature lens of context, celebration, and nostalgia,โ€ director David Weiner told Bloody Disgusting. โ€œDare I say it, but this newest In Search of Darkness documentary may very well be the best in the series yet.โ€

In Search of Darkness is the fifth installment in the series covering genre films in the latter part of the twenty century, which also includes a trilogy dedicated entirely to the โ€˜80s, as well as In Search of Tomorrow, a film all about the great sci-fi films of the โ€˜80s. Creator VC, the studio behind In Search of Darkness, has also produced In Search of the Last Action Heroes, about โ€˜80s action films, and FPS, about the history of first-person shooter video games.
